Avg. price for Canadian rental unit hits record high in 2023-06
https://www.ctvnews.ca/business/average-asking-price-for-canadian-rental-unit-hits-record-high-in-june-rentals-ca-1.6478222
https://rentals.ca/national-rent-report

*avg. price for rental unit in Canada reached a record $2,042 last month amid continued interest rate hikes, population expansion, low unemployment
* Vancouver was Canada's priciest city for renters: 1-bedroom $2,945; 2-bedroom $3,863

Landlords Are Pushing the Supreme Court to End Rent Control

Two landlord lobbying groups are petitioning the Supreme Court to overturn New York City’s rent stabilization law, which would allow further countrywide challenges to rent control. Real estate billionaires friendly with court justices are backing the move.

How much you need to make ea. year to buy home in Vancouver, British Columbia
https://bc.ctvnews.ca/here-s-how-much-you-need-to-make-each-year-to-buy-a-home-in-vancouver-1.6566365

* minimum annual income needed to buy home in Vancouver $250,000
* increase, according to Ratehub.ca, due to interest rates; came despite a small dip in avg. home price
